How to Convert Kilojoule to Pound-Force Inch
1 kJ = 8850.74571515486 lbf*in
Example: convert 15 kJ to lbf*in:
15 kJ = 15 × 8850.74571515486 lbf*in = 132761.185727323 lbf*in

Kilojoule
A kilojoule (kJ) is a unit of energy equal to 1,000 joules, used to quantify energy transfer or work done.
History/Origin
The kilojoule was introduced as part of the International System of Units (SI) to provide a convenient scale for measuring energy, especially in fields like nutrition and physics, replacing the joule for larger quantities.
Current Use
The kilojoule is widely used in nutrition to express food energy content, in physics and engineering to measure energy transfer, and in various scientific and industrial applications within the 'Energy' converter category.
Pound-Force Inch
Pound-force inch (lbf·in) is a unit of torque representing the torque resulting from a one-pound-force applied at a perpendicular distance of one inch from the pivot point.
History/Origin
The pound-force inch has been used historically in engineering and mechanical contexts to quantify torque, especially in the United States, based on the imperial system of units. It originated from the need to measure rotational force in machinery and automotive applications.
Current Use
Today, pound-force inch is still used in engineering, automotive, and mechanical fields to specify torque values, particularly in the United States. It is often converted to SI units like newton-meters for international standardization.
